Windows Vista Release Date Editions Licenses Etc.

While for the most part corrected in later patches and updates, several initial system stability issues plagued Vista—this was a major contributing factor to its poor public image. Windows Vista Release Date Windows Vista was released to manufacturing on November 8, 2006, and made available to the public for purchase on January 30, 2007. It’s preceded by Windows XP, and succeeded by Windows 7. The most recent version of Windows is Windows 11, released on October 5, 2021....

Will Putin Drop A Nuclear Bomb On Ukraine Here S What Americans Think

When asked: “Do you think it is a realistic possibility that Russian President Vladimir Putin may use a nuclear bomb in Ukraine?” 14 percent of eligible U.S. voters said “very realistic,” with 44 percent saying it was “realistic.” Another 19 percent said nuclear use is “neither realistic nor unrealistic,” whilst just 12 percent of Americans described it as either “unrealistic” or “very unrealistic.” Between October 23 and 24, 1,500 “eligible voters in the United States” were surveyed, with the poll conducted by Redfield & Wilton Strategies for Newsweek....
